High Movie Review #14: Rudolph the Red-Nosed Reindeer

Ho! Ho! Ho! All right, let’s get to this Christmas movie. One of the most classic Christmas movies. It really established a certain style of Christmas imagery for movies and advertising. It was made by Rankin/Bass Productions and they made several other stop-motion Christmas TV specials. High Movie Review #010: history of the entire world, i guess

history of the entire world, i guess is a movie that was released on May 10, 2017 by bill wurtz on youtube. It tells the story of the last 13.8 billion years in the span of 19 minutes and 25 seconds.
